Yosemite's Badger Pass Ski Area Celebrates SpringFest with Ski Contests, Costumes and Revelry
Author: DNC Parks & Resorts at Yosemite
Published on Mar 27, 2008 - 9:55:14 AM

DATE: Sunday, March 30, 2008

LOCATION: Badger Pass Ski Area, Yosemite National Park

EVENT SUMMARY: Yosemite National Park's ski resort will celebrate another successful season with its annual SpringFest Carnival, complete with music, food, costumes and crazy contests.

SCHEDULE OF EVENTS:

9:00 a.m.: Race Registration; Sign up at the Activities Desk or in the Snowflake Room, upstairs in the Badger Pass Day Lodge

10:00 a.m.: Obstacle Course for children 13 and under; Meet in front of Badger Pups Den

11:00 a.m.: Free Style Competition for skiers and snowboarders over 14 years old; Meet on Lower Red Fox Run

11:00 a.m.: Slalom Race for children under age 13; Meet at Bruin Run

12:00 p.m. - 4:00 p.m.: Live music with the "Adam Burns Band".

12:30 p.m.: Costume Contest on the Day Lodge Main Deck

1:00 p.m.: Dummy Judging; Visitors and employees can build their own dummy and display it in front of the Day Lodge. Dummies must be at least 3' tall and less than 100 lbs., non-breathing, non-living, no pets, no kids. Gravity propelled only.

1:30 p.m.: Dual Slalom Race for skiers and snowboarders over 14 years old; Meet at the top of Badger Run

4:00 p.m.: World Cup Dummy Race; Watch the decorated dummies careen down Red Fox Run and root for your favorite
